A borrower's bankruptcy attorney requests copies of all loan documents to prepare for proceedings. The borrower verbally authorized the MLO to cooperate but has not provided written consent. What should the MLO do?
Correct Answer
B) Require written authorization from the borrower before disclosure
Even though the attorney represents the borrower's interests, privacy regulations typically require written authorization for disclosure of nonpublic personal information to third parties, including attorneys, unless specifically compelled by court order.
